Choose devices according to linux-libre code

  • Done
  • quality assurance status badge
Details
5 participants
  • Chris Marusich
  • David Larsson
  • Ludovic Courtès
  • swedebugia
  • znavko
Owner
unassigned
Submitted by
znavko
Severity
normal
Z
Z
znavko wrote on 28 Oct 2018 19:45
LPvzcBE--3-1@tutanota.com
Hello, Guix Help!

As I've got here https://lists.gnu.org/archive/html/help-guix/2018-10/msg00083.html https://lists.gnu.org/archive/html/help-guix/2018-10/msg00083.html
some devices cannot work without linux-firmware, requiring non-free software drivers. It is so bad.

I believe the issue can be solved by choosing devices that have proper support by linux-libre code. So how to do this? Is there any info how to choose devices working nice on linux-libre?
Attachment: file
S
S
swedebugia wrote on 30 Oct 2018 10:56
b9bb34f1-d4cc-ebfb-a033-06ce8091139d@riseup.net
Hi


On 2018-10-28 19:45, znavko@tutanota.com wrote:
Toggle quote (8 lines)
> As I've got here
> https://lists.gnu.org/archive/html/help-guix/2018-10/msg00083.html
> some devices cannot work without linux-firmware, requiring non-free
> software drivers. It is so bad.
>
> I believe the issue can be solved by choosing devices that have proper
> support by linux-libre code. So how to do this? Is there any info how
> to choose devices working nice on linux-libre?
L
L
Ludovic Courtès wrote on 22 Nov 2018 10:28
(address . znavko@tutanota.com)
87h8g9cvfy.fsf@gnu.org
Hello,

<znavko@tutanota.com> skribis:

Toggle quote (9 lines)
> As I've got here
> https://lists.gnu.org/archive/html/help-guix/2018-10/msg00083.html
> some devices cannot work without linux-firmware, requiring non-free
> software drivers. It is so bad.
>
> I believe the issue can be solved by choosing devices that have proper
> support by linux-libre code. So how to do this? Is there any info how
> to choose devices working nice on linux-libre?

The manual gives a couple of hints:


The problem is of course not specific to GuixSD, that’s why the manual
refers to H-Node, but there are probably other similar resources out
there.

HTH,
Ludo’.
Closed
D
D
David Larsson wrote on 22 Nov 2018 12:15
(name . Ludovic Courtès)(address . ludo@gnu.org)
alpine.LNX.2.21.9999.1811221213430.12650@localhost
Here's a list of places where you can get hardware that should be
compatible:

--
HTH
David Larsson

On Thu, 22 Nov 2018, Ludovic Courtès wrote:

Toggle quote (26 lines)
> Hello,
>
> <znavko@tutanota.com> skribis:
>
>> As I've got here
>> https://lists.gnu.org/archive/html/help-guix/2018-10/msg00083.html
>> some devices cannot work without linux-firmware, requiring non-free
>> software drivers. It is so bad.
>>
>> I believe the issue can be solved by choosing devices that have proper
>> support by linux-libre code. So how to do this? Is there any info how
>> to choose devices working nice on linux-libre?
>
> The manual gives a couple of hints:
>
> https://www.gnu.org/software/guix/manual/en/html_node/Hardware-Considerations.html
>
> The problem is of course not specific to GuixSD, that’s why the manual
> refers to H-Node, but there are probably other similar resources out
> there.
>
> HTH,
> Ludo’.
>
>
>
C
C
Chris Marusich wrote on 30 Nov 2018 03:12
Close 33190 because it is not a bug
(address . control@debbugs.gnu.org)
878t1bcnzs.fsf@gmail.com
tags 33190 notabug
close 33190
quit

I am closing this bug report because it is not a bug in Guix or GuixSD;
it is a problem caused because the reporter's hardware requires non-free
software to function. Guix and GuixSD do not support non-free hardware.
If I have misinterpreted your bug report, please feel free to re-open
the bug report and explain the problem in more detail.

As for your question on how to deal with the situation, I see that you
emailed help-guix@, so any further discussion about that topic can
happen there. Generally speaking, I'm sure people will be happy to help
you choose hardware that does not require non-free software, or to work
around hardware that does.

Thank you,

--
Chris
-----BEGIN PGP SIGNATURE-----

iQIzBAEBCAAdFiEEy/WXVcvn5+/vGD+x3UCaFdgiRp0FAlwAnIcACgkQ3UCaFdgi
Rp3ozBAA0KaUZbl5FFIMT5crwPgmMfIaQvyOYUdTgzDsMWul5FreXhuaphQSHAtI
QJLipEa6aChU5Z/ywGN9erJTIbRXn22FelqLkqMRhKkjI2u0n3DUPhsrhj2US2uY
LsfSdkRzqG068UvQGRend5RIzthIPkWuBUM1KVj7iJ4ml0030+otVWi1k66WUHnD
Q9o85FFT5ZHhqQBavvz/fqRt+Q5Ejiy4h17uqlNjiwvKp5uBW6nyL1N77qGyPcS9
RfFhNj/8DZr7XV7PGH7DPEVxOa+hF+R3pyuORribZn2UI4SCawDkcWnvkSnOODaX
31LtL6CcvKdFotv7+sFeYH5ZQH3xWeb3tWBzx8Sh7jxf0Vy8hyoHPi2qMNFdoSyU
ROoy9eK955H36LT80l3QbwzWXeyfgUnKSIcMmI/mtjtNyUKzGsOUoPT9nJHsYckj
Mm/LJWHzCcFFdJalFBKxLHia0TV68mvbsXwnhp0Yd/2cEc8NF0vqirY97Nqb+pWF
EHduA/QdhmJMaR+U7Wr1o1/FwMdFf9F0jFeaJDD3easqeuRJs4vCcFN27YI9g2G4
OQX0ettEyZ6vJeqsQPVU6VmouGLAo+s9LdCZdyauED6akPWNwIStQrY+Vl4NZj5h
F9sq7tPTpbZ+XG+PBXXBs4w+WXIBDgPwH6yMSqfliy7PSawZq4g=
=LSa5
-----END PGP SIGNATURE-----

?